Paraplegic landmine victim faces fourth night on hospital trolley

Marco Sabatini Corleone, 58, spoke about his concerns last night as he faces into a fourth night on the trolley tonight in a therapy room off the Mercy University Hospitalās (MUH) emergency department in Cork City.
āI am tired and not sleeping because of the noise of the emergency department,ā Marco told the Irish Examiner. āIām just fed up waiting for a bed. I have plates in my back as a result of my spinal injuries, and Iām supposed to lie on an air mattress. Iām not supposed to be on a hospital trolley for this long. The staff here are wonderful. They are trying their best. But itās just with all the cutbacks, they are short of beds. Iām now at risk of developing pressure sores. And if I get breakdowns, it can take a long time to heal.ā
